שחר סרברניקdawnser

בעידן שבו אינטליגנציה מלאכותית הופכת לחלק בלתי נפרד מחיינו, הנדסת פרומפטים (Prompt Engineering) מתגלה כמיומנות מפתח חיונית. אבל מהי בדיוק הנדסת פרומפטים, ולמה היא כל כך חשובה? במאמר זה נצלול לעומק הנושא ונגלה כיצד ניתן להשתמש בה באופן אפקטיבי.

מהי הנדסת פרומפטים?

הנדסת פרומפטים היא האמנות והמדע של ניסוח הוראות ושאלות למערכות בינה מלאכותית באופן שיוביל לתוצאות הטובות ביותר. זוהי מיומנות המשלבת הבנה טכנית של אופן פעולת מודלי שפה גדולים (LLMs) עם יכולת ניסוח מדויקת ויצירתית.

למה הנדסת פרומפטים חשובה?

  1. שיפור איכות התוצאות: הנדסת פרומפטים נכונה יכולה להעלות משמעותית את איכות התשובות שמתקבלות ממודלי AI.
  2. חיסכון בזמן ומשאבים: במקום לנסות שוב ושוב, ניסוח נכון מוביל לתוצאה הרצויה מהר יותר.
  3. התאמה מדויקת לצרכים: פרומפטים מתוכננים היטב מאפשרים לקבל תוצאות המותאמות בדיוק למה שנדרש.

עקרונות בסיסיים בהנדסת פרומפטים

1. בהירות ודיוק

הבהירות היא אחד העקרונות החשובים ביותר בהנדסת פרומפטים. ככל שההנחיה ברורה ומדויקת יותר, כך גדל הסיכוי לקבל תשובה מדויקת ורלוונטית. למשל:

במקום לכתוב: “ספר לי על חתולים” עדיף לכתוב: “תאר את ההבדלים העיקריים בין גזעי החתולים הפופולריים ביותר לגידול ביתי, כולל מאפייני התנהגות ודרישות טיפול ייחודיות”

2. הקשר ופירוט

מתן הקשר מלא ופרטים רלוונטיים מסייע למודל ה-AI להבין טוב יותר את המטרה ולספק תשובה מותאמת יותר. כדאי לכלול:

  • מטרת השימוש בתוצר
  • קהל היעד
  • סגנון הכתיבה הרצוי
  • דוגמאות ספציפיות למה שמצופה

3. מבנה וארגון

פרומפט מאורגן היטב מקל על המודל לעבד את המידע ולהגיב בהתאם. שימוש בסעיפים, רשימות ומספור יכול לעזור בארגון המידע.

טכניקות מתקדמות בהנדסת פרומפטים

1. Chain-of-Thought (שרשרת חשיבה)

טכניקת Chain-of-Thought מעודדת את המודל לחשוב באופן לוגי ושיטתי. במקום לבקש תשובה ישירה, מבקשים מהמודל לפרט את תהליך החשיבה שלו:

“חשוב צעד אחר צעד כיצד לפתור את הבעיה הבאה…”

2. Few-Shot Learning (למידה מדוגמאות)

שיטה זו כוללת מתן מספר דוגמאות של תבנית התשובה הרצויה לפני הצגת השאלה העיקרית. למשל:

שאלה: מהו כלב? תשובה: כלב הוא חיית מחמד נאמנה ממשפחת הכלביים.

שאלה: מהו חתול? תשובה: חתול הוא חיית מחמד עצמאית ממשפחת החתוליים.

שאלה: מהו ארנב? [כאן המודל ילמד מהתבנית ויענה בצורה דומה]

3. Role Prompting (הגדרת תפקיד)

הגדרת תפקיד ספציפי למודל יכולה לשפר משמעותית את איכות התשובות:

“אתה מומחה בתחום הפיזיקה הקוונטית. הסבר בצורה פשוטה ומובנת את עקרון אי-הוודאות של הייזנברג.”

כלים וטכנולוגיות בהנדסת פרומפטים

1. מערכות AI פופולריות

  • ChatGPT: מודל השפה של OpenAI, מתאים במיוחד לשיחות ומשימות טקסטואליות
  • Claude: מודל של Anthropic, ידוע ביכולות הניתוח והכתיבה המעמיקות שלו
  • DALL-E: מתמחה ביצירת תמונות מתיאורים טקסטואליים
  • Midjourney: מערכת נוספת ליצירת אמנות ותמונות באמצעות AI

2. כלי עזר להנדסת פרומפטים

  • Prompt generators: כלים אוטומטיים ליצירת פרומפטים מותאמים
  • Template libraries: ספריות של תבניות פרומפטים מוכנות לשימוש
  • Testing tools: כלים לבדיקת יעילות הפרומפטים

שימושים מעשיים בהנדסת פרומפטים

1. בתחום העסקי

  • כתיבת תוכן שיווקי
  • ניתוח נתונים ודוחות
  • שירות לקוחות אוטומטי
  • פיתוח רעיונות ופתרונות יצירתיים

2. בחינוך

  • יצירת חומרי לימוד מותאמים אישית
  • סיוע בהכנת מערכי שיעור
  • תרגול ובדיקת ידע
  • פיתוח שאלות ותרגילים

3. בפיתוח תוכנה

  • דיבוג קוד
  • כתיבת תיעוד טכני
  • יצירת תבניות קוד
  • אופטימיזציה של קוד קיים

אתגרים ומגבלות בהנדסת פרומפטים

1. הטיות ודיוק

מודלי AI עלולים לסבול מהטיות שונות ולעתים לספק מידע לא מדויק. חשוב:

  • לבדוק את המידע ממקורות נוספים
  • להיות מודעים להטיות אפשריות
  • להשתמש בטכניקות לצמצום הטיות

2. מורכבות ועקביות

  • קושי בשמירה על עקביות לאורך זמן
  • אתגרים בטיפול במשימות מורכבות
  • צורך בפיצול משימות גדולות למשימות קטנות יותר

טיפים מתקדמים להנדסת פרומפטים יעילה

1. אופטימיזציה מתמדת

  • בדיקה וניסוי של גרסאות שונות
  • איסוף משוב ולמידה מטעויות
  • התאמה מתמדת לשינויים בטכנולוגיה

2. שימוש בתבניות

פיתוח תבניות קבועות יכול לחסוך זמן ולשפר עקביות:

 
מטרה: [הגדרת המטרה]
הקשר: [מידע רקע רלוונטי]
פורמט רצוי: [מבנה התשובה המבוקש]
מגבלות: [דרישות או מגבלות ספציפיות]
דוגמה: [דוגמה לתוצר הרצוי]

מגמות עתידיות בהנדסת פרומפטים

1. אוטומציה והתפתחות

  • כלים חכמים יותר לייצור פרומפטים
  • שילוב למידת מכונה בתהליך הנדסת הפרומפטים
  • התפתחות סטנדרטים ושיטות עבודה מקובלות

2. אינטגרציה מתקדמת

  • שילוב עם מערכות ארגוניות
  • פיתוח ממשקים חכמים
  • התאמה אישית מתקדמת

סיכום

הנדסת פרומפטים היא תחום מתפתח ודינמי שהופך לחיוני יותר ויותר בעולם המונע על ידי AI. ההבנה והשליטה בעקרונות ובטכניקות של הנדסת פרומפטים יכולות להוביל לשיפור משמעותי באיכות התוצאות ובאפקטיביות השימוש במערכות AI.

צעדים להמשך

  1. התחילו בפרויקטים קטנים ופשוטים
  2. תעדו את הניסיונות והתוצאות שלכם
  3. הצטרפו לקהילות מקצועיות בתחום
  4. התעדכנו בחידושים וטכניקות חדשות

זכרו שהנדסת פרומפטים היא מיומנות שמשתפרת עם הניסיון והתרגול. ככל שתתנסו יותר, כך תפתחו הבנה טובה יותר של מה עובד ומה לא, ותוכלו ליצור פרומפטים אפקטיביים יותר.